Knuckles is an inventive neighborhood gem in Montreal's dining scene that masterfully sits at the intersection of a fine-dining kitchen & a nostalgic greasy spoon. They excel at turning comfort food classics completely on their heads, offering a menu that is equal parts playful, indulgent, & seriously well-executed.
?
The clear standout of the meal is the Tartare Big Wac, a dish that proves to be an absolute triumph. It arrives styled exactly like a classic fast-food double cheeseburger, complete with a toasted sesame seed bun, a mountain of shredded iceberg lettuce, melted cheese, thick pickle slices, & a signature sauce that captures that unmistakable, nostalgic fast-food tang. Instead of a beef patty, it is packed with a generous, impeccably seasoned beef tartare that is rich, tender, & beautifully studded with whole-grain mustard. The crunchiness & structure of the bun offer a fantastic textural contrast to the soft, velvety tartare, while the acidity & brightness of the sauce perfectly cut through the richness. It delivers exactly the flavor profile you hope for, wrapped in a genuinely impressive presentation. It is easily the winner of the night.

Equally essential to the experience are the Signature Panzerotti, a staple born from a beloved recipe passed down from the co-owner's Nonna. These deep-fried, savory turnovers eat like a premium, elevated'pizza pocket' with the flavors cranked up to eleven. Fried to a deep, golden-brown perfection, they boast an incredible, bubbly, & shattering crust. Knuckles serves up a rotation of creative fillings like Spicy Roni (pepperoni, jalapenos, & pecorino) or Cheesesteak (ground beef, onions, marinated hot peppers, & ricotta). Skewered with a pickle or hot pepper to balance the fried indulgence & served alongside a wonderfully creamy dipping sauce, they are incredibly satisfying, delightfully messy, & a mandatory order for the table.

For a softer contrast, the Fresh Herb Gnocchi showcases the kitchen's dedication to scratch-made pasta. These pillowy, vibrant green herb gnocchi swim in a rich, buttery, & translucent emulsified sauce, heavily dusted with a snowcap of finely grated Parmesan cheese & a sprinkle of toasted, aromatic spices or breadcrumbs for texture. The gnocchi themselves are beautifully cloud-like. While the sauce is exceptionally savory & well-executed, it leans into a more delicate, comforting profile compared to the bold, punchy flavors of the tartare.
